[Case report: hemiballism due to a putaminal cavernous hemangioma]
Summary
A rare case of reversible hemiballism in a woman was linked to a putaminal cavernous hemangioma. Hemiballism symptoms fluctuated with minor hemorrhages and absorption, suggesting a unique pathophysiology.

Background:
- Hemiballism is a rare hyperkinetic movement disorder.
- Putaminal lesions can cause hemiballism, but reversible cases are exceptionally rare.
Observation:
- A 51-year-old woman presented with left-sided hemiballism and weakness.
- Cranial CT revealed a high-density, enhancing lesion in the right putamen.
- MRI showed an isodense lesion on T1 and a ring-like low-signal area on T2, suggestive of cavernous hemangioma.
Findings:
- CT-guided stereotaxic biopsy revealed gliosis and calcification, not cavernoma.
- A small hemorrhage occurred post-biopsy, temporarily ceasing hemiballism.
- Hemiballism recurred as the hemorrhage resolved, indicating a fluctuating neurological state.
Implications:
- The on-off hemiballism suggests a pathophysiology involving fluctuating putaminal lesion activity and its effect on basal ganglia pathways.
- This case highlights the complex relationship between cavernous hemangiomas, hemorrhage, and movement disorders.
- Understanding this mechanism may inform future management strategies for similar rare neurological presentations.
